3. 8% is impressive? What election is he talking about? She needed over 10% minimum.
She had a 20% lead just four weeks ago.

It is accepted by most of the pundits that anything less than 10% would be good for Obama, and 8% or less could be considered a win by him, considering the situation. And at the very least, she needed over 10% to indicate that at least in her own territory there was a strong movement to vote for her.

There is apparently no strong movement to vote for her.
